Output 58bbcd60bae956f5f6f91c247111ad42d8ab0fc857ef83e9148e5df533581987:15

value
691854
script pubkey
OP_0 OP_PUSHBYTES_20 6389e63ea8d4fffded2e817771195513b79f0188
address
bc1qvwy7v04g6nllmmfws9mhzx24zwme7qvgkv3w4q
transaction
58bbcd60bae956f5f6f91c247111ad42d8ab0fc857ef83e9148e5df533581987